Relevant community guideline:
LOT CONDITION, SIGNS. In the event the owner of any lot fails to keep and maintain the lot in a good condition, free of trash or weeds and grass over 18" in height, the developer shall have the right to clean, mow and maintain the said lot and charge the owner.
